Output 65d76626ba9c901a8058059ddfc11efb06cebcf5e24eb50f26b710728fa0f26a:0

value
3405856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abb006bf8c6cd090cde008bb70e6d67e718ee0d5 OP_EQUAL
address
3HLpLsZxuNHZbJLmVdSmdTvu2nJUkKkrfB
transaction
65d76626ba9c901a8058059ddfc11efb06cebcf5e24eb50f26b710728fa0f26a
spent
true